Output 70d3de6def5402dff81d87b6dbd2bcec3f280e2674953718144d86cac107ee29:1

value
422906
script pubkey
OP_0 OP_PUSHBYTES_20 ce32fc612d4cf65f4dc5bc2128d25a7b69cd1f02
address
bc1qece0ccfdfnm97nw9hssj35j60d5u68czzt7te0
transaction
70d3de6def5402dff81d87b6dbd2bcec3f280e2674953718144d86cac107ee29